Output 18a177dbe83f0786829d91f030791e33320a8eac5ad991cddd27540d37c7b7cb:0

value
16854708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70618a7d5253152967209224740dd1d5053278e3 OP_EQUAL
address
3BwETJ2xCGdLAKPKn8ZsDroR8y17ubkrdh
transaction
18a177dbe83f0786829d91f030791e33320a8eac5ad991cddd27540d37c7b7cb
spent
true